Documents Required for Freezone Business Setup Sharjah
Valid Passport Copies of Shareholders and Managers – You must provide clear, valid copies of the passports belonging to all shareholders and company managers. Also, The passport should be in good condition and must be valid for a minimum of six months at the time of application. However, These are required for identity verification and to process your business license and visa, if applicable.
UAE Residency Visa or Emirates ID (If Applicable) – If any of the individuals involved in the company are currently residing in the UAE, a copy of their valid residency visa and Emirates ID must be submitted. Although, This helps the Freezone authority assess your current residency status and determine if additional documents like a No Objection Certificate are needed.
Proposed Business Activity & Trade Name Options – You will be asked to define your planned business activities so the Freezone can determine the appropriate license type. Along with this, you should submit 2–3 trade name options for your company. These names must comply with UAE naming laws and will be subject to availability and approval.
Recent Passport-Size Photograph (White Background) – Each shareholder or manager must provide a recent, high-resolution passport-sized photograph with a white background. In addition, These photos are used for Emirates ID processing, residency visa issuance, and internal Freezone records.
No Objection Certificate (NOC) – If Employed in the UAE If you are currently employed or sponsored under another entity in the UAE, you may need to provide a No Objection Certificate (NOC) from your employer or sponsor. This document confirms that they have no objection to your involvement in a new Freezone business.
Proof of Residential Address – Certain Freezones may request proof of your current residential address as part of their KYC (Know Your Customer) procedures. Acceptable documents include a recent utility bill, tenancy contract, or bank statement—ideally issued within the last 2–3 months and showing your full name and address.
Bank Reference Letter (Optional) – Although not mandatory for all Freezones, some may request a bank reference letter, especially when assisting with corporate bank account opening. This letter should confirm that you hold an account in good standing with your current bank and may improve your banking application process.
